编译HelloWorld.java失败

问题描述

HelloWorld.java代码如下:package tutorial;import com.opensymphony.xwork2.Action;public class HelloWorld { private String name; public String getName() { return name; } public void setName(String name) { this.name = name; } public String execute() { name = "Hello, " + name + "!"; return SUCCESS; }}直接在命令行下编译时提示如下错误:HelloWorld.java:3: 软件包 com.opensymphony.xwork2 不存在import com.opensymphony.xwork2.Action; ^HelloWorld.java:18: 找不到符号符号: 变量 SUCCESS位置: 类 tutorial.HelloWorld return SUCCESS; ^2 错误我也安装了JDK、JRE,CLASSPATH设置了JDKlib与JRElib目录,不知道怎么回事???

解决方案

大哥 你缺少的是struts2的包啊 和jre没关系的啊

时间: 2024-08-31 14:57:23

编译HelloWorld.java失败的相关文章

使用spark自带的sbt编译工具打包失败

问题描述 使用spark自带的sbt编译工具打包失败 小菜目前刚学spark,安装spark的操作系统环境是ubuntu 12.0.4.安装的scala是scala-2.9.1.final.tgz.配置好环境变量后,通过git clone git://github.com/aparch/spark.git下载spark源代码后,执行命令sbt/sbt update complie,出现信息如下: NOTE: The sbt/sbt script has been relocated to bui

编译错误-freeglut安装问题:已按照网上步骤进行,编译freeglut项目失败

问题描述 freeglut安装问题:已按照网上步骤进行,编译freeglut项目失败 1.生成 2.编译 问题描述细节:编译方式中debug.release和静态配置全部使用过,都是undefined symbols的问题.另外,我读了freeglut项目中的说明文档,有这么一个提示:Windows Questions======= =========(1) My linking fails due to undefined symbols. What libraries do I need t

利用javax.tools动态编译执行java代码

inkfish原创,请勿商业性质转载,转载请注明来源(http://blog.csdn.net/inkfish ). 参考:使用 javax.tools 创建动态应用程序   javax.tools 包是一种添加到 Java SE 6 的标准 API,可以实现 Java 源代码编译,使您能够添加动态功能来扩展静态应用程序.本文将探查javax.tools包中提供的主要类,以Java表达式表示计算一个数值函数y=x*x+x.更多详情请参考<使用 javax.tools 创建动态应用程序>和jav

mingw-Code::Blocks Windows环境下编译HelloWorld程序报错,求高手支招!

问题描述 Code::Blocks Windows环境下编译HelloWorld程序报错,求高手支招! 很简单的Hello World 程序,编译时提示: D:MinGWincludec++3.4.5bitscodecvt.h|475 这个文件中引用的 bits/codecvt_specializations.h 文件找不到 请问是哪里出了问题? ?

gcc-mac编译安装pyodbc失败

问题描述 mac编译安装pyodbc失败 我想在 mac 中使用 python+odbc 的方式实现远程访问 oracle 数据库,所以下载了 pyodbc-3.0.7的源码在本地编译.按 README 中的方法执行 python setup.py build install 时遇到报错如下: www:pyodbc-3.0.7 Philip$ python setup.py build installrunning buildrunning build_extbuilding 'pyodbc'

服务器-class文件反编译为Java

问题描述 class文件反编译为Java SQL server 2008+myclipse+tomcat开发OA系统时,如何把tomcat服务器下的项目还原在myclipse中编译. 解决方案 Java Decompiler 这个东东就比较好用http://www.bkill.com/download/20100.html 解决方案二: 1.建一个自己的工程 2.反编译classess下的文件(工具很多,后期要做很多修复工作),作为自己的源码 3.拷贝相应的lib 4.jsp,js等资源考到we

apk反编译后安装失败,找不到证书

问题描述 apk反编译后安装失败,找不到证书 反编译apk,将dex转为jar,修改.class,再将jar转为dex打包回apkjarsigner签名(验证,显示有签名信息),经过这些过程后,新的apk始终安装失败,为何?直接复制apk到/data/app里,启动时报类未找到异常.求解! 解决方案 不知道是为什么jarsigner签名无效~~~使用aignapk签名后成功了. 解决方案二: 如果系统里面已经安装没有改过的apk 现在反编译了,并签名,如果签名和以前的不一样的话,与原版apk会冲

ant-ANT编译nutch时失败,请问大神们这是什么原因呢?

问题描述 ANT编译nutch时失败,请问大神们这是什么原因呢? 但是ANT执行还是报错如下: 提示错误:You probably access the destination server through a proxy server that is not well configured. 如图所示: (1)以下是本程序的目录结构: (2)已经在build.xml中设置好了. taskdef uri="antlib:org.sonar.ant" resource="org

android apk反编译到java源码的实现方法_Android

Android由于其代码是放在dalvik虚拟机上的托管代码,所以能够很容易的将其反编译为我们可以识别的代码. 之前我写过一篇文章反编译Android的apk包到smali文件 然后再重新编译签名后打包实现篡改apk的功能. 最近又有一种新的方法来实现直接从Android apk包里的classes.dex文件,把dex码反编译到java的.class二进制码,然后从.class二进制码反编译到java源码想必就不用我来多说了吧. 首先我们需要的工具是dex2jar和jd-gui 其中第一个工具